[ARCHIVED] Help Us Name Three New Parks!

The Department of Parks, Recreation and Community Services has initiated the public participation process for naming three new proffered park sites. One site is located south of Marblehead Drive in the Potomac Green community. The property includes approximately 27 acres with three rectangular athletic fields, one baseball/softball field, trails, open space, a picnic pavilion and tennis court, restrooms and parking.

Another new park consists of approximately 61 acres along Goose Creek, adjacent to the Belmont Glen Village community. This passive park site will feature picnic areas and a trail that connects to the Goose Creek Preserve and adjacent communities, as part of the Goose Creek Stream Valley Corridor.

The third proffered site consists of approximately 5.4 acres along the western side of Belmont Ridge Road (between Sungrove Terrace and Blemont Glen Place). This site includes picnic areas, a tot lot, parking and pervious-surface trails connecting to the Goose Creek Preserve and adjacent communities, as part of the Goose Creek Stream Valley Corridor.
